DETAILED DESCRIPTION OF THE INVENTION [Industrial Application Field] The present invention relates to a printing press, and more particularly to a printing plate mounting device for mounting a printing plate on a plate cylinder of an offset printing press.

[Prior Art] Generally, an aluminum PS plate (Presensitized Plat) is used as a printing plate mounted on a plate cylinder of an offset printing press.
e) Paper or resin plates are known.

Of these, the PS plate and the resin plate are thick, so they can print a large number of prints, but on the other hand, they are more expensive than the paper plate, and the plate cylinder is attached and detached with a vise. It had to be clamped to the torso, and the work of attaching and detaching was troublesome. For this reason, thin plates such as paper plates have been used in recent years when the number of prints is small, but thin plates such as paper plates are weaker than conventional PS plates and resin plates, so they are directly attached to the plate cylinder. Cannot be installed.

Also, even if it is directly mounted on the plate cylinder, wrinkles may occur due to position adjustment after mounting on the plate cylinder.

Conventionally, when using a thin plate such as a paper plate,
As shown in FIGS. 13 and 13, a plate mounting plate 53 for mounting a thin plate 52 such as a paper plate is provided on the upper surface of the vice 51 on the biting side of the plate cylinder 50, and a PS plate previously mounted on the plate cylinder 50 is provided. A plate having a normal thickness, such as a plate 54 (this plate may be a plate that is no longer required after use) may be used as a support, and a paper plate or the like having a thinner peripheral surface than the plate Was attached to the plate mounting plate 53 by hooking it.

When adjusting the position of the thin printing plate 52 with respect to the plate cylinder 50, the plate plate 54 having the same thickness as that of the normal plate is used.
And the thin printing plate 52 is moved integrally with the base plate 54.

[Problem to be Solved by the Invention] The conventional plate mounting plate 53 is provided with a hole 52 'of the plate 52 in the plate mounting plate 53 when a thin plate 52 such as a paper plate is mounted on the plate cylinder 50. As it is designed to be hooked on a large number of hooks 53 ', it is difficult to hook when the plate is wide, and if the plate is wavy during the hooking work, it often comes off from the hook 53' once hooked. A lot of time was spent on plate installation.

Moreover, since the hook 53 is fixed by biting the vice 51 on the biting side, when using a normal PS plate without using a paper plate or a thin PS plate, the hook 53 is located between the vice table 5 and the clamp plate 13. Is very complicated because it is necessary to adjust the gap with the spherical bolt 15.

Therefore, in the printing of a small lot using a conventional thin printing plate, the work efficiency is remarkably reduced, for example, the printing plate replacement time is longer than the actual printing time.

The present invention has been made in view of the above points, and its purpose is to quickly and easily and accurately mount a thin printing plate such as a paper plate on a plate cylinder. The present invention is to provide a printing plate mounting device for a printing press which can perform the printing operation.

[Means for Solving the Problems] In order to achieve the above object, a plate mounting device for a printing press according to the present invention accommodates a plate vice device in a notch formed along a longitudinal direction of a plate cylinder, In a plate positioning device for a printing press provided with a clamp plate for clamping a plate at an upper end of the plate vise, a plate positioning to be inserted into a reference hole of the plate on an upper surface of a clamp plate of a biting plate vise. A reference body pin, the reference pin comprising: a main body for positioning the printing plate; and a locking head provided at an upper end of the main body for preventing the printing plate from floating. The height of the reference pin in contact with the reference hole of the printing plate is made substantially equal to the thickness of the printing plate, and the head of the reference pin can be reduced in the radial direction, and formed slightly larger than the reference hole of the printing plate. That is, the tip of the head is tapered. Further, the main body and the head may be formed of different members.

Embodiment An embodiment of the present invention will be described below in detail with reference to FIGS.

In the figure, reference numeral 1 denotes a plate cylinder. The plate cylinder 1 has a cutout 2 for accommodating plate vice devices 3 and 4 on the biting side and the rear side of the plate over the entire length of the cylinder.
Is provided. In the notch 2, a vise table 5, 5 'slightly shorter than the entire length and formed in a substantially rectangular cross section is accommodated. As shown in FIG. 7, a dovetail groove is formed at the lower end of the vise table 5, 5 'so as to fit into an engagement piece 6 fixed to the bottom of the notch 2 with a bolt 7. Therefore, vise stand 5,
5 'is restricted from rising from the bottom surface of the notch 2 via the engagement piece 6.

Reference numerals 8 and 9 denote bolts for positioning the vise stands 5, 5 'with respect to the plate cylinder 1, and a plurality of bolts are provided in the longitudinal direction of the vise stands 5, 5'. Reference numeral 10 denotes a compression spring inserted into the opposing hole 11 of the vise table 5, 5 ', and biases the vise table 5, 5' in a direction approaching the wall surface of the notch 2.

Reference numerals 12 and 13 denote clamp plates formed to divide the vise tables 5, 5 'into approximately four equal parts in the longitudinal direction of the plate cylinder. Each of the clamp plates 12, 13 has a bolt hole having a spherical concave seat. 14 are drilled in two places each.

Screw holes are formed in the vise tables 5, 5 'so as to correspond to the bolt holes 14, and the clamp plates 12, 13 are held on the vise tables 5, 5' by spherical bolts 15. Also,
A groove 16 having a substantially semicircular cross-section is formed over the entire length of the vise table 5, 5 'on the side opposite to the clamp, and a clamp shaft 17 is supported in the groove 16.

A notch 18 having an L-shaped cross section is formed on the clamp shaft 17. By rotating the clamp shaft 17, an edge of the clamp plates 12 and 13 is engaged with the notch 18. Has become.

Therefore, the clamp plates 12, 13 are pivotally supported by the spherical bolt 15 and the spherical concave seat so that they can swing.

On the other hand, an eccentric shaft 19 is provided between the clamp-side end face of the buttocks vise 5 'and the side face of the notch 2 over the entire length of the plate cylinder 1.
By rotating the eccentric shaft 19, the plate-side vise device 4 on the rear side can slide toward the plate-vise device 3 on the biting side.

Therefore, PS having a normal thickness by the plate vise 3
After biting one end of a plate or a resin plate, the plate is wound around the plate cylinder 1 and the other end is fixed by the plate vise device 4 on the rear side.

上記の構成は従来の版胴装置と同様である。 The above configuration is the same as that of the conventional plate cylinder device.

In the present invention, a position corresponding to the reference hole 20a of a thin printing plate 20 such as a paper plate or a PS plate having a thickness of about 0.15 mm to 0.24 mm is provided on the upper surface side of the clamp plate 12 of the plate cylinder 1 thus configured. In addition, a reference pin 21 for plate positioning, which is integrally formed of an elastic material such as a synthetic resin or rubber, is provided.

The reference pin 21 is a main body for positioning the printing plate 20.
And a locking head 24 provided at the upper end of the main body 22 for preventing the printing plate 20 from floating. The main body portion 22 of the reference pin 21 has an outer diameter substantially equal to the reference hole 20a of the printing plate 20, and makes the height in contact with the reference hole 20a of the printing plate 20 substantially equal to the thickness of the printing plate 20. Is formed with a screw portion 23. The head 24 has a shaft 25 extending upward from the center of the upper end of the main body 24, and a plurality of elastic legs 26 projecting radially downward from the tip of the shaft 25. The outer shape of the lower end composed of each elastic leg 26 is formed so as to have a slightly larger diameter than the reference hole 20a of the printing plate 20, and the reference hole 20a of the printing plate 20 is pushed in from above to make the reference hole. When the elastic leg 26a is fitted to the elastic leg 26, the elastic leg 26 is bent inward so as to reduce the outer diameter by its elastic force, and has a diameter substantially equal to the inner diameter of the reference hole 20a.

In this embodiment, three reference pins 21 are provided on the clamp plates 12 on both sides of the plate cylinder 1, respectively. However, the number of the reference pins 21 is not limited to this and may be appropriately selected and provided. Just do it.

Further, the reference pin 21 is exemplified by one having six elastic legs 26, but the number of elastic legs 26 is not limited to this, and may be appropriately selected and formed. In addition, the reference pin
Although the screw portion 23 is screwed into the clamp plate 12, the screw portion 23 may be formed into a cylindrical shape and pressed into the clamp plate 12 so as to be held by elastic force.

[Operation] Next, the operation of mounting a thin plate such as a paper plate by the plate mounting device of the present invention will be described.

First, a base plate 28 serving as a base, or a plate having a normal thickness such as a PS plate as a substitute for the base plate 28 is mounted on the plate cylinder 1 by a biting-side plate vise device 3 and a rear-side plate vise device 4. Therefore, if a plate having a normal thickness such as a PS plate is previously mounted on the plate cylinder 1 and can be used as the plate 28, it is not necessary to newly mount the plate 28.

After the plate 28 is mounted on the plate cylinder 1, the reference holes 20a of the thin printing plate 20 such as a paper plate are aligned with the reference pins 21 and pushed in from above as shown in FIGS. At that time, the reference hole 20a of the printing plate 20
Is slightly smaller than the outer diameter of the lower end of the reference pin 21, so that when the plate 20 passes through the elastic legs 26, the elastic legs 26
The lower end is bent inward with the upper end serving as a fulcrum by the twenty reference holes 20a. (The outer diameter is reduced.) When the reference hole 20a of the printing plate 20 passes through the elastic leg 26, the elastic leg 26 returns to its original shape by its elastic force. The upper surface of the printing plate 20 is pressed by 7 to prevent the printing plate 20 from floating.

After the reference hole 20a of the printing plate 20 is fitted in the main body 22 of the reference pin 21 in this manner, the printing plate 20 is preliminarily coated with water, oil, or glue on the entire surface or pasted with a double-sided adhesive tape. It is mounted on the plate cylinder 1 along the plate 28 and attached to the plate 28.

Therefore, the printing plate 20 is securely mounted on the plate cylinder 1 via the plate 28. If the position of the printing plate 20 and the plate cylinder 1 is to be adjusted, the normal plate can be adjusted by adjusting the positions of the vice devices 3 and 4 on the biting side and the rear side which clamp the platen 28. Can be performed in the same manner as when the camera is mounted.

When removing a thin printing plate 20 such as a paper plate or a thin PS plate from the plate cylinder 1, remove the end of the printing plate from the plate cylinder 1, and hold the end portion away from the plate cylinder 1. The printing plate 20 can be easily removed because the reference hole 20a is broken.

The head 24 of the reference pin 21 and the head 24 may be separately manufactured, and the head 24 may be attached to the upper surface of the main body 22 with bolts or the like. In this case, the material of the main body 22 is made of a synthetic resin, a metal, or the like, and the material of the head portion 24 is made of a synthetic resin (a metal may be used if it can be made of a metal).

Further, as shown in FIG. 11, the head 24 of the reference pin 21 may have a shape in which the upper surface of a cone is cut. In this case, it is preferable to use a resilient material such as synthetic rubber or raw rubber.

[Effects of the Invention] As described in detail above, according to the invention, the printing plate can be positioned only by inserting the reference holes of the thin printing plate such as a paper plate into alignment with the reference pins. The plate can be quickly and accurately mounted. Moreover, when the reference hole of the printing plate is inserted into the reference pin, the upper surface of the printing plate is pressed by the lower end surface of the head of the reference pin, and the printing plate can be prevented from floating. Therefore, there is an effect of reliably preventing the printing plate from coming off the reference pin. Further, since the reference pin is provided on the upper surface of the clamp plate, there is no hindrance to the work of mounting the printing plate by the plate vise.

Further, since the head of the reference pin is detachable from the main body of the reference pin, the head can be easily replaced when the head is damaged or worn.
